随着区块链技术的发展和普及,虚拟币交易平台变得越来越重要。它们不仅是进行加密货币交易的地方,更是用户存储和管理数字资产的工具。这其中,源码钱包作为构建虚拟币交易平台的重要组成部分,逐渐受到开发者和创业者的关注。本文将深入探讨虚拟币交易平台源码钱包的构建与应用,详细介绍其后台的运作机制、功能需求,以及如何从零开始搭建这样一个平台。
1. 虚拟币交易平台源码钱包的基本概念
虚拟币交易平台源码钱包是指用户在虚拟币交易平台上使用的数字资产存储和管理工具。它们通常是开源的,允许开发者根据自己的需求进行二次开发。源码钱包的优势在于透明性高、安全性好以及可定制性强,能够更好地满足不同用户和市场的需求。
一个虚拟币交易平台的源码钱包一般包括数字货币的获取、存储、转账和安全等多个模块。用户可以通过钱包实现与交易平台的交互,方便地进行虚拟币的管理和交易。
2. 源码钱包的主要功能
虚拟币交易平台的源码钱包应具备多种功能,以满足用户的需求:
- 资产管理:用户可以随时查看和管理自己的数字资产,包括余额、交易历史、资产分类等。
- 转账功能:支持用户之间的虚拟币转账,并能够动态计算交易费用。
- 安全性:通过多重签名、冷存储等手段确保用户的资金安全,防止潜在的黑客攻击。
- API接口:为开发者提供API接口,方便他们与其他系统的对接,增强平台的功能。
- 用户系统:包括用户注册、登录、身份验证等功能,确保每个用户都有独立的账户。
3. 如何构建虚拟币交易平台源码钱包
搭建一个虚拟币交易平台源码钱包并不是一项简单的任务,以下是一些主要步骤:
- 选择技术栈:开发者需要决定使用哪种编程语言和框架,如Node.js、Python等。同时,还需选择合适的数据库来存储用户信息和交易记录。
- 设计系统架构:在构建源码钱包之前,需要规划好系统的架构,包括前端、后端和数据库的设计。这将直接影响到系统的可扩展性和性能。
- 开发钱包功能:从资产管理到转账功能,逐步实现各项功能。每完成一个模块,都要进行充分的测试,确保其稳定性和安全性。
- 实现安全机制:在开发过程中,要特别注意安全性。可以采用加密算法、密钥管理等技术来增强系统的安全性。
- 上线与维护:在开发完成后,进行全面的测试,确保系统的正常运行。上线后需要定期维护和更新代码,修复可能出现的安全漏洞。
4. 常见问题解答
虚拟币交易平台源码钱包的安全性如何保障?
安全性是虚拟币交易平台最为重要的考量因素之一。为了保障源码钱包的安全性,开发者可以从多个方面进行强化:
- 多重签名:通过多重签名技术,确保任何交易都需要多个密钥的协同确认,这样可以大大提高安全性。
- 冷存储:将大部分资金存储在offline(离线)环境中,减少资金遭受网络攻击的风险,只有小部分资金留在热钱包中以供日常操作。
- 定期安全审计:定期进行安全审计和渗透测试,确保系统不存在已知漏洞。
- 用户教育:对用户进行安全防范知识的教育,教会他们如何选择强密码、启用双重认证等措施。
通过以上多重防护措施,源码钱包的安全性得以显著提升,增强用户对交易平台的信任感。
如何选购合适的源码钱包平台?
选择一个合适的源码钱包平台对于开发者非常关键,以下几点可以作为参考:
- 开源性:选择标准的开源钱包平台,确保源代码是公开可用的,这样可以方便进行二次开发和功能扩展。
- 社区支持:选择一个活跃的社区支持的平台,这样能够获得持续的技术支持和更新。
- 文档齐全:选择有详细文档的源码钱包平台,能够更容易理解和上手。
- 安全性评估:通过网络查询平台的安全性评估报告,了解其在安全性方面的表现如何。
合适的源码钱包平台不仅能提升开发效率,还能为日后运营提供保障。
源码钱包的开发过程中的常见挑战有哪些?
在开发虚拟币交易平台的源码钱包时,开发者可能会面临以下挑战:
- 安全漏洞:由于区块链技术发展的迅速,诸多新技术也随之涌现,这就使得原本已有的安全措施可能在新技术面前显得力不从心。因此,必须不断更新安全防护措施。
- 用户体验设计:好的钱包需要友好的用户界面和用户体验,这就需要开发者多方面考量用户的需求和习惯。
- 合规性针对各国法律法规的不同,开发者需要确保自己的钱包符合当地的法规,以避免后续的法律风险。
- 技术更新:在迅速发展的区块链市场上,技术更新换代极快,开发者必须及时学习和适应新技术,以保持系统的竞争力。
这些挑战要求开发者具备良好的技术能力及应变能力,以确保项目顺利推进。
未来虚拟币交易平台发展的趋势是什么?
虚拟币交易平台的未来发展趋势主要体现在以下几个方面:
- 加强合规性:随着各国对虚拟货币监管的加强,未来的交易平台需要更好地适应法规,通常需要建立反洗钱、客户身份验证等合规机制。
- 提升用户体验:通过前端交互和界面设计,增强用户体验,以吸引更多的用户注册和使用。
- 引入人工智能:人工智能和大数据的引入有望提高交易的智能化程度,通过分析用户数据,提供个性化的服务。
- 多链支持:未来的交易平台可能不仅支持比特币或以太坊,还可能支持多条链的资产交易,实现资产的互通性。
综上所述,虚拟币交易平台的发展有着广阔的前景,开源钱包更是其中不可或缺的一部分。通过不断的技术创新和市场适应,各个交易平台将会在激烈的竞争中不断进化和成长。
随着虚拟币市场的持续发展,源码钱包的设计和构建将成为许多开发者和创业者关注的焦点。希望本文的介绍能够为大家在构建虚拟币交易平台源码钱包的过程中提供帮助和指导。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。